Frequently Asked Questions about New the 80204 ZIP Code Apartments

What is the Cheapest New apartment in 80204?

Currently the most affordable New Apartment in 80204 is at Sparta505 - Student Housing listed at $1,260.

How much is the average rent for a New 80204 Apartment?

The average rent for a New Apartment in 80204 is $3,730.

What is the largest New 80204 Apartment for rent?

Today's New apartment with the most square footage in 80204 is a 2,030 square feet unit starting from $2,850 at One South Market.

What is the average size for 80204 New Apartments for rent?

The average size for a New rental in 80204 is currently at 530 sq ft.
